Yes, Pravetz is definitely a Bulgarian brand and from what I've understood it is a Pravetz-16T model with NEC V20 CPU. EC-1839 - it is only a soviet id for one of the communist countries computers. A kind of clone unification attempt. By the way, Pravetz had clones also, one of them was manufactured in Soviet Union in Moldova and called Compecs V20-12. It is told that they were built from parts coming from Pravetz factory in Bulgaria.
